The `svc-thumbwright` account runs the Thumbwright image cache on the Kestrelmoor cluster. Last week's sync confirmed the leak: evicted tiles keep a live reference through the decode pool, so resident memory grows roughly 90 MB per hour under load. The patched build frees the pool handle on eviction and is rolling out behind the `tw-evict-fix` flag. Restarts are no longer needed nightly. For metrics verification, the account must still authenticate to the internal telemetry gateway using the key below.

service key, fawip-bajef: kto11_Qt5wZK9vdNC

## Ownership

The Stockmend reconciliation job runs nightly at 02:00 and compares warehouse counts against ledger snapshots. If it fails twice consecutively, page rather than retry; partial runs can corrupt the delta table. Runbook lives in the ops folder. Do not restart mid-run. For escalations, configuration changes, or anything not covered by the runbook, contact the owner listed below.

account owner for fajep-yagef: Kasix Eliiel

Action item (P2): The Gridling crossword generator produced unsolvable puzzles after the dictionary refresh because the fill validator skipped words containing diacritics. Add a validation pass that rejects any grid with uncheckable entries before publish, and a regression test covering the refreshed Marrowfield dictionary. Reviewers should confirm the fix against the failure cases catalogued on the internal page below.

operations page: https://vault.qorvelcorp.example/settings

**Mgmt Meeting Minutes — Retiring the Brightline Range**

Quick recap for sales leads at Fenholt Supplies: we agreed to retire the Brightline fixture range by year-end. Remaining stock moves to clearance pricing next month, and accounts on standing orders get migrated to the Lumetta range. Trade-in incentives were approved in principle. The confidential note on next steps sits just below.

board note of bajof-bajeg: The pricing group signed off on a budget of $13.4 million for Project Sildor. The renewal with Lamixek Holdings closes at $48.9 million a year, 49 percent above the last contract.